Teenager Killed in Motor Vehicle Collision in Clifton

Passaic County Prosecutor Camelia M. Valdes and Clifton Police Chief Thomas Rinaldi announce that on March 2, 2025, at approximately 12:30 a.m., the Clifton Police Department responded to the intersection of Lakeview Avenue and Crooks Avenue on a report of a motor vehicle collision. Officers learned that a 2008 Honda Accord carrying four occupants collided with a 2011 Mazda CX-9 with one occupant. A 17-year-old passenger in the Honda Accord was pronounced deceased at the scene.

The cause of the vehicle crash is undetermined at this time. This investigation is active and ongoing. More information will be released when it becomes available.
